You have to set the image tag nested inside of the hyperlink tags if you wish to use an image.
<a href="http://www.website.com"><img src="http://www.website.com/image.gif" /></a>
But if you prefer to use the slogan or name of your company instead, replace the image tags with the text you want to use.
<a href="http://www.website.com">Your text here</a>
Whatever you put, image source or text between the hyperlink reference tags, will become click-able and link directly to your site, or whatever website address (URL) you put in the reference tags.

When you sign up for tumblr, it automatically asks you to make a URL. If you would like to change your URL, go to Customize -> Info -> URL. You can change it to whatever you please from there.
An URL is the exact internet address to find a particular page or document on it's host site. A web address is an address that takes you to a website, which might not be as specific as an URL.
HTML is a language used to create web pages. A URL is the address of the page or another internet resource. So HTML and URL are not the same kind of thing. It is the address of a html page that would be a URL, but not HTML itself.HTML is a language used to create web pages. A URL is the address of the page or another internet resource.
